As of 2022, South Lockport, located in Niagara County, NY, reported a steady annual increase in prescription opioid misuse.
Niagara County recorded over 200 drug-related arrests in 2022, with a significant fraction stemming from South Lockport.
In 2021, South Lockport faced a 15% rise in heroin-related overdoses, reflecting broader trends in Niagara County.
Around 70% of drug abuse cases in South Lockport involved individuals aged 18-35, based on 2022 data.
Niagara County had one of the highest rates of emergency room visits for drug overdoses in upstate New York in 2022.
South Lockport saw a 10% increase in methamphetamine-related incidents in 2021 compared to the previous year.
Employers in South Lockport, NY, are increasingly adopting stringent drug testing policies as part of their workforce management strategies. These policies are designed to ensure a safe and productive work environment by discouraging drug misuse among staff.
Many companies mandate pre-employment drug screenings and conduct random tests throughout employment. This approach helps to deter illegal drug use, also promoting employee health and reducing workplace accidents.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A)
Local businesses also provide access to employee assistance programs, offering support for individuals struggling with addiction. These initiatives are crucial in helping employees seek help without the fear of losing their jobs, fostering a supportive community-oriented workplace culture.
The government of South Lockport, NY, along with Niagara County, has undertaken various initiatives to combat drug abuse. These include partnerships with local law enforcement, rehabilitation centers, and community groups to provide education and outreach. Efforts also focus on reducing the availability of illegal substances through increased surveillance and enforcement. Niagara County Government
The state government of New York has also contributed to addressing the issue by providing funding for treatment facilities in South Lockport. They have implemented programs aimed at prevention and support for recovering addicts, working in collaboration with federal agencies to tackle the root causes of drug abuse.
